How Long Is the Arkansas River? Unveiling a Continental Waterway
The Arkansas River, a major tributary of the Mississippi, stretches for approximately 1,469 miles (2,364 kilometers) from its headwaters high in the Colorado Rockies to its confluence with the Mississippi River in southeastern Arkansas. This vital waterway traverses six states, impacting ecosystems, economies, and communities along its extensive journey.

The Source: Origins in the Rockies
The river originates high in the Sawatch Range of the Colorado Rockies, near Leadville, Colorado. Snowmelt from these towering peaks feeds the nascent Arkansas, setting it on its long journey eastward. The precise location considered the “official” source can vary, leading to minor discrepancies in total length measurements.

The Mouth: Meeting the Mighty Mississippi
The Arkansas River ultimately empties into the Mississippi River near Napoleon, Arkansas. This confluence marks the end of its independent journey and contributes significantly to the Mississippi’s flow, impacting downstream ecosystems and navigation.

FAQ 3: Is the Arkansas River navigable for its entire length?
No, the Arkansas River is not navigable for its entire length. Commercial navigation is primarily focused on the portion downstream from Muskogee, Oklahoma, thanks to the McClellan-Kerr Arkansas River Navigation System. The upper reaches are often shallow and turbulent, making them unsuitable for large vessels.
FAQ 4: What is the McClellan-Kerr Arkansas River Navigation System?
The McClellan-Kerr Arkansas River Navigation System (MKARNS) is a system of locks and dams that makes the Arkansas River navigable for commercial barge traffic from the Mississippi River to Muskogee, Oklahoma. This system has significantly boosted the economies of Arkansas and Oklahoma.

FAQ 6: How has human activity impacted the Arkansas River?
Human activity has significantly impacted the Arkansas River in various ways:
- Dam Construction: Dams have altered flow patterns, sediment transport, and aquatic habitats.
- Agricultural Runoff: Agricultural runoff introduces pollutants, such as fertilizers and pesticides, into the river, impacting water quality.
- Industrial Pollution: Industrial discharges can contaminate the river with heavy metals and other harmful substances.
- Water Diversion: Water is diverted from the river for irrigation, municipal water supplies, and industrial use, reducing its flow.

FAQ 9: What are the major tributaries of the Arkansas River?
Some of the major tributaries of the Arkansas River include:
- Cimarron River
- Canadian River
- Neosho River (Grand River)
- Verdigris River
- Poteau River

FAQ 11: What are some of the challenges facing the Arkansas River today?
The Arkansas River faces several significant challenges, including:
- Water Scarcity: Increasing demand for water puts pressure on the river’s flow, especially during dry periods.
- Pollution: Agricultural runoff, industrial discharges, and urban stormwater runoff continue to degrade water quality.
- Habitat Loss: Dam construction and channelization have altered natural habitats along the river.
- Climate Change: Climate change is expected to exacerbate water scarcity and increase the frequency of extreme weather events, such as droughts and floods.
